Upcoming year may very well be a turning point for our sector- Nusrat Mahmud, Director, Hamid Fabrics Ltd

nusrat-mahmudTextile Industry is the main foreign remittance earning sector for Bangladesh. This industry suffered a lot during the COVID -19 pandemic. Now the industry is trying to recover the gaps. Recently Textile Focus Conversation with  Nusrat Mahmud, Director, Hamid Fabrics Ltd  regarding on observation of 2021 and expectation for the year  2022.
Textile Focus: How are you observing 2021 for your business?
Nusrat Mahmud:  It’s an endurance test, really, with each quarter presenting a different set of challenges. Curveballs aside, 2021 feels familiar again.

Textile Focus: What is your expectation and planning for 2022?

Nusrat Mahmud:  2022, may very well be a turning point for our sector where only those agile few, who nurture continuous improvement in products, services and experiences, will survive.
